DoIHaveTheSause? – [Ski Mask The Slumped God]

Ski Mask The Slumped God is obviously a favorite here on our pages, and tonight he is making his way back with his brand new music video for “DoIHaveTheSause?”! He joined forces with his right hand man Cole Bennett to direct this visual, and if you know even the slightest about their past it’s clear that he picked the right man for the job, and the final product only enforces that. Check out this brand new music video below and if you like it be sure to let me know in the comments section!